Discoveries and Surveys in New Guinea & the D'Entrecasteaux Islands. A Cruise in Polynesia and Visits to the Pearl Shelling Stations in Torres Straits.

London: J. Murray, 1876. Hardcover. Moresby commanded the H.M.S. Basilisk to Australia in 1871 and was then engaged in surveying work along the south-east coast of New Guinea. He discovered the harbor of Port Moresby and China Strait, and re-discovered Milne Bay. He retired from the British navy as an admiral. 328 pp, ads, 4 plts, 3 maps.
